Witryna13 lut 2024 · TAXES 19-07, New York State Income Tax Withholding Published: February 13, 2024 Effective: Pay Period 03, 2024 Summary The Single or Head of Household and Married withholding tax table brackets and rates for the State of New York will change as a result of changes to the formula for tax year 2024. WitrynaThe special nonresident tax rate has increased from 1.25% to 1.75% in 2016. By law, the nonresident tax rate must equal the lowest local income tax rate paid by Maryland residents (currently 1.75%) combined with the top state tax rate. Employers must withhold Maryland income tax for nonresidents using the 1.75% rate. Witryna14 mar 2024 · A W-4 is a form that you are required to fill out when joining a new company.
